Notes
Mastered for Sonic One.
© 2006 Black Hole Recordings
Made in Holland.
1-3: Mix name is not listed.
1-14: The remix is exclusive to this mix and the vinyl sampler; it is not the same remix that is on the regular 12" release.
1-15: The song was later released as "Deep Skies Feat. Cassandra Fox - Little Bird (Mike Koglin Remix)".
2-10: Mix name is not listed, however Carrie Skipper is credited for vocals - it's the "Instrumental Mix" instead of the "Vocal Mix".
Tiësto's notes on the tracks:
1-01: This beautiful intro brings me right back to Malibu Beach, perfect to listen to when you're on the beach.
1-02: Mark Norman show they can also produce warm tracks with lots of emotion. Totally different from their normal work but still energetic.
1-03: I love the lyrics in this track! I really can relate to this track walking in a major city, but you still feel 'by yourself'.
1-04: This track was given to me by a guy in record shop Deltadiscos in Ibiza. It's housey but still got this trancy feel, that's why I love it!
1-05: I was playing in Brasil on the beach in January and the DJ before me played this track. I went to him to get it because it's a perfect track for a beachparty! Again it's house but has trance influences and the lyrics gotta be made for this mixcomp...
1-06: Leama & Moor are some of my favorite producers and with a remix of Matthew Dekay you can't go wrong. This one does really well on the floor.
1-07: A new and exclusive track of Matthew which he made esspecially for this compilation. Does a lot of damage on the floor as well!
1-08: It's a cover of a Bilie Ray Martin song, but done so well that I couldn't resist to include it.
1-09: Very nice vocals in this one and a beautiful melody as well.
1-10: Awesome warm track, remix of another great producer from Holland.
1-11: Amazing new track of amazing singer JES, whatever she sings, I am sold!
1-12: This track sounds like an old Depeche Mode or New Order track, it's trance but very original.
1-13: I just love the bassline in this one, very uplifting and beautiful track.
1-14: I played this one in every set in my short Latin American tour and every night people went off! A 100% exclusive remix which will never be released.
1-15: The vocal in this track is very original, amazing voice, especially in the break she sings epic. This one goes down really well in clubs.
2-01: Perfect intro to set the tone for disc 2, LAX is a very nice lounge in Los angeles.
2-02: This DJ comes out of nowhere and produces one bomb after another!
2-03: Great producer from germany DJ Shah makes another killer! I love the flute in this track.
2-04: Two great producers from Holland who make beautiful original trance music. Watch out for their album, full of great tracks like this one...
2-05: This track has a very simple melody, but it's so hypnotic that it stays in your head forever!
2-06: This one sounds funky but has a great drive and a warm melody. Very good track!
2-07: The original is already a classic and exclusive for the compilation. Jonas Steur made an excellent 2006 remix.
2-08: With Ozgur Can it's always hit or miss. This track is definitely a hit, very energetic but still warm.
2-09: Great track which will go in every environment, small club or big party.
2-10: This track is the new style I like a lot. Groovy, almost house but with lots of trancy influences.
2-11: Amazing reworked vocal in this track which was given to me by my good friend Nick McGeachin just 1 hour before I started mixing In Search Of Sunrise. After listening, I couldn't resist squeezing it in.
2-12: This track has been huge for me, brings back great memories of my set in Amsterdam in December last year.
2-13: I love the original but it's too slow for me to play out, so I was happy to find this remix. Could be a great track to end the night with or as an encore this coming summer.
